The Most Streamed Songs of 2018

Most Streamed Songs of 2018

Billboard has released their year end charts and one of the most exciting is the Most Streamed Songs of 2018. Drake features heavily on the chart as does Cardi B. Post Malone notches up multiple appearances on the hip-hop heavy chart.

Billboard - Most Streamed Songs of 2018

1. God's Plan - Drake
2. Rockstar - Post Malone ft 21 Savage
3. Perfect - Ed Sheeran
4. Psycho - Post Malone ft Ty Dolla $ign
5. In My Feelings - Drake
6. Sad! - XXXTENTACION
7. Havana - Camila Cabello ft Young Thug
8. Lucid Dreams - Juice WRLD
9. I Like It - Cardi B ft Bad Bunny & J Balvin
10. Meant To Be - Bebe Rexha & Florida Georgia Line

11. Nice For What - Drake
12. I Fall Apart - Post Malone
13. Look Alive - BlocBoy JB ft Drake
14. Despacito - Luis Fonsi & Daddy Yankee ft Justin Bieber
15. Believer - Imagine Dragons
16. Yes Indeed - Lil Baby & Drake
17. Ric Flair Drip - Offset & Metro Boomin
18. Gucci Gang - Lil Pump
19. Girls Like You - Maroon 5 ft Cardi B
20. Better Now - Post Malone

21. Boo'd Up - Ella Mai
22. FEFE - 6ix9ine ft Nicki Minaj
23. Walk It Talk It - Migos ft Drake
24. Plug Walk - Rich The Kid
25. Gummo - 6ix9ine
26. Bodak Yellow (Money Moves) - Cardi B
27. Taste - Tyga ft Offset
28. MotorSport - Migos, Nicki Minaj & Cardi B
29. Mine - Bazzi
30. No Limit - G-Eazy ft A$AP Rocky & Cardi B

Source: Billboard Year End Charts: Streaming Songs
